TICKET — Missed pick-up: paper ledgers for archiving

The scheduled collection of fourteen boxed ledgers from the Harrowfield branch did not happen this morning; no driver arrived and no cancellation was logged. The boxes remain sealed in the records room, inventoried and strapped to a single pallet. Please rebook the run for the next available slot and notify the branch administrator of the new window. For the rebooked run, the hand-over instruction below is confidential and should be passed to the courier verbally.

handover note for yagef-bagep: the drudor pelius courier leaves the kasdor zorvan norir ledger at gate 8016 under passcode 755406

## Approvals: ParcelPing Webhook

Changes to the ParcelPing tracking webhook require one reviewer sign-off before merge. The webhook receives carrier status events from the Droverline network and fans them out to customer notification queues. Review focus: retry semantics, payload schema versioning, and idempotency keys. Schema changes additionally require an approval from the integration lead. All approvals are recorded in the ownership register under the current responsible engineer.

named custodian: Brivan Eliath Quenox Frador

Ticket #— Floor 9 Opening Prep, Brindlemoor House

Hi facilities folks, Floor 9 opens to staff next Monday and we need a few things squared away before then. Lift access is live, but the two side doors by the kitchenette are still on the old lock config — please reprogram them before Friday. Also, signage for the quiet rooms hasn't arrived, so pop up the temporary printed ones for now. Until the badge readers sync, the interim door code for Floor 9 is below.

door code, bajop-bajog: bdg-DSWAC-43621

Runbook: Veldspar invoice renderer. If PDFs come out blank, restart the render pool first; a stuck font cache is the usual cause. Check queue depth in the Harkwell dashboard before scaling. Do not touch the template store mid-render — partial writes corrupt the layout index. Confirm your change matches the staging profile before approving. The renderer runs with the following configuration values.

deployment values, taweg-bajop:
[fenvan]
port = 5672
team = holmir
host = fenvan.orvexio.example
region = lower-1
access_code = ac_b98bc6
timeout_ms = 1500